Abstract

A legal encyclopaedia that provides a comprehensive overview of Australian law, this is a must-have reference tool for legal professionals in private and public sectors, librarians and students. 89 titles cover both mainstream and little known subject areas. Principles of law presented in a succinct propositional style and supported by extensive references to Australian legislative and judicial authority allow users to quickly find the required information and conduct further research. Each subject is written by highly-experienced and well-regarded authors and then extensively checked to ensure accuracy.
